Webb2 Answers. You can either allow them to connect to your machine using the http://192.168.1.1 address or you can create a name that maps to 192.168.1.1. How you create the name depends on what infrastructure you have. If you have a local DNS server then add the name pointing to 192.168.1.1 into that. Webb21 aug. 2016 · 1 If your computer is known on the network as win7.welcome.net and the website is running on port 82 then your website would be available on http://win7.welcome.net:82 In some cases, if your homepage is not a standard one you would need to add it to the url : http://win7.welcome.net:82/startPage.html
